Freddie Mac sells $3.5 billion in bills

(Reuters) - The six-month bills were priced at 97.4424 and have a money
market yield of 5.221 percent, and the 12-month bills were
priced at 94.9997 and have a money market yield of 5.220
percent. Settlement is June 26.




The sale was part of Freddie Mac's weekly bill auction, on
Wednesday Freddie Mac will sell $2.5 billion in one-month bills
due July 25, 2007.
